A teenage boy in Western Australia could avoid punishment after pleading guilty to indecent assault against reality TV star Ellie Rolfe. The incident occurred during her morning walk when the boy rode by on his bike and grabbed Ms. Rolfe on the buttocks, causing her to drop her phone and yell at him. The boy apologized to the police for his actions, stating it was a “stupid mistake.” The court is considering a youth court order, which may involve counseling, as a possible outcome for the case. Magistrate Matthew Walton referred the boy to court conferencing to determine the details of the youth court order.

Ms. Rolfe, who won season 11 of The Bachelor, took to Instagram to express her frustration and disappointment about the incident. She recounted how the boy followed her on his bike, grabbed her without consent, and then rode off. Ms. Rolfe emphasized the disrespect of the boy’s actions and highlighted the lack of safety even during a morning walk in broad daylight. The matter is set to return to court in September, and the boy’s bail was extended. The court hearing for the teenage boy highlighted the impact of his actions on Ellie Rolfe and the need for appropriate consequences. The police prosecutor presented CCTV footage of the incident, providing evidence of the assault. The boy’s defense attorney acknowledged the incident as a lapse in judgment and suggested a youth court order as a potential resolution. The magistrate expressed concerns but referred the boy to court conferencing to determine the specifics of the youth court order. If completed without issue, the court may not impose any punishment on the boy, raising questions about accountability for his actions.
